Neil began training his first Mountain Rescue Search dog in the mid 1970s and, when they qualified in the Cairngorms two years later, he introduced the Search And Rescue Dog Association, (SARDA), to Ireland. His main achievements to date are:


  • 1976    Qualified as Search and Rescue Dog handler.
  • 1985    Qualified Assessor of Search and Rescue Dogs.
  • 1992    Trained first ever Water Search Dog in UK.
  • 1998    Trained drugs dog under ex Home Office examiner/instructor.
  • 1999    Training Officer for Canis Specialist Search Dogs.
  • 1999    Trained in Leisure Trade security services.
  • 2000    Accepted as Specialist Support Services for UKFSSART.
  • 2001    Trained explosives search dog with the military.
  • 2002    Accepted as Specialist Support Services for NI Fire Service.
  • 2003    Member of British Institute of Professional Dog Trainers.
  • 2004    Chairman of S A R D A (Ireland – North).
  • 2004    Appointed dog handler to NI Fire Service USAR Team.
  • 2005    Invited by ODPM to be search dog instructor at UK Fire College.
  • 2005    Trained an Arson Detection Dog for an Italian commercial team.
  • 2006    Trained World’s first optical discs detection dogs.
  • 2020    Awarded PhD for his research into the untrained response of pet dogs to the onset of epileptic seizure in their owners.
  • 2021    Awarded the title of Visiting Scholar at the School of Biological Sciences Queen's University Belfast.
